- [00:00:27.622]Architectural engineering, in my mind really,
- [00:00:30.211]is engineering for buildings.
- [00:00:33.100]It's much different than architecture.
- [00:00:35.259]So it's really the technical side of architecture.
- [00:00:38.630]And we are typically looking for students
- [00:00:42.545]that are strong in math and physics,
- [00:00:45.577]but love buildings and have a passion for buildings,
- [00:00:49.515]but don't wanna give up that math and science.

- [00:01:32.802]I think some of the challenges
- [00:01:33.781]that upcoming architectural engineers may have
- [00:01:35.850]to face is the ability to adapt
- [00:01:39.210]to all of the changing technology.
- [00:01:42.068]Not just technology in design,
- [00:01:44.099]but technology in construction, technology
- [00:01:47.095]in the tools that we use.
- [00:01:48.600]And I think today's architectural engineer
- [00:01:50.900]is gonna have to be very adaptive
- [00:01:53.392]and eager to continue their education
- [00:01:56.560]and to continue learning as they go throughout their career.

- [00:02:52.988]They have to work together in big teams
- [00:02:54.530]a lot more than they've ever had to in the past.
- [00:02:57.069]And that integration is critical,
- [00:02:59.939]and architectural engineers that have background
- [00:03:03.252]in all of those areas is gonna be very,
- [00:03:06.962]very highly sought-after.
- [00:03:08.463]I think the industry is going to continue to blossom.
- [00:03:11.020]I think architectural engineers are going to be in demand.
- [00:03:14.180]Part of the reason I think the demand will be so high
- [00:03:16.399]for architectural engineers is because
- [00:03:17.780]of our ability to collaborate
- [00:03:19.752]and integrate with all of the disciplines.
- [00:03:22.191]So, we have to be able to work
- [00:03:23.784]and talk to an architect, but we also have
- [00:03:25.362]to be able to work with the structural engineer,
- [00:03:27.420]and the mechanical, and the electrical.
- [00:03:29.751]And then all of the other disciplines,
- [00:03:31.220]even outside of what you consider the mainstream.
- [00:03:34.180]All of these things that come together
- [00:03:36.009]to make the building that is the built environment
- [00:03:38.775]that people wanna live in, and grow in, and enjoy.
